**The role**:
We are excited to announce an exceptional opportunity for an enthusiastic and self-motivated individual to join our team. As part of our research initiatives on Air Quality and Energy Systems, you will work with existing IoT testbeds. These testbeds have been developed under two prestigious Horizon-funded projects, TwinERGY and TwinAIR.

This part-time position offers a flexible work schedule of 20 hours per week, and is available for an immediate start. Join us in this exciting research journey and be part of a team dedicated to shaping the future of Air Quality and Energy Systems.

**What will you be doing?**:

- Undertaking applied, hands-on research and industry R&D on IoT systems used for energy and air quality monitoring.
- Collaborating with research group members and consortium members; contributing to the maintenance of the TwinERGY and TwinAIR testbeds.
- Leading and contributing to the authoring of journal and international conference publications.
- Assisting with general project administration duties, such as the authoring of verbal and written reports and project deliverables.
- Representing the University in project meetings, presenting your work, taking feedback and developing your individual research directions.
- Creating and maintaining technical documentation.

If you are excited about becoming part of an international consortium of partners and undertaking high technology readiness, applied research, we encourage you to apply. A track record in one or more of the following areas is desirable: low-power communications and networking for battery-powered, severely constrained wireless embedded devices, machine learning (preferably with experience in distributed/federated AI or embedded neural networks), and strong software and firmware development skills using Python or C.

Furthermore, you should have a solid understanding of the complexities involved in developing working prototypes of research ideas. Prior experience in industry, the ability to thrive in a large, international team of engineers and researchers, and a talent for building strong and effective relationships across different sectors and levels of seniority are also highly valued. Excellent communication skills, both verbally and in writing, are essential for this role.
